About Aether Keepers
Aether Keepers positions itself as a chaotic intersection between incremental progression and high-stakes tower defense. Developed and published by Buff Lab, the Aether Keepers release date is scheduled for July 13, 2026, exclusively on PC. The game pivots on the tension between fragile starting units and the eventual power fantasy of a massive, unstoppable army. Rather than focusing on static towers, you manage a mobile legion of soldiers tasked with protecting a mysterious Core from encroaching demonic waves.
Tactical Healing and Scaling in Aether Keepers
The central gameplay loop revolves around the "Core Nanny" mechanic, a role that forces you to prioritize unit sustain over pure offensive output in the early game. Because your initial squad is vulnerable, the strategy hinges on active healing and damage mitigation. This creates a distinct rhythm where your survival depends on keeping a circle of protection active until your economy allows for the next leap in power. It is a game of endurance that rewards those who can bridge the gap between a weak start and the late-game "god mode" state.
